The Intersection of AI and Travel

Understanding AI in the Travel Sector

AI technology in travel primarily manifests through data analytics, personalization tools, and automation of processes, enhancing customer experiences in ways that were unimaginable a decade ago. Major airlines and travel booking platforms utilize AI algorithms to analyze customer data, improving service delivery and operational efficiency. For instance, AI-driven virtual assistants can provide 24/7 service, answering queries and assisting with bookings seamlessly. However, the implications for sustainability are multi-faceted. A study from McKinsey indicates that up to 40% of the travel sector's emissions could be reduced through technology solutions, including AI.

Environmental Impacts of AI in Travel

Carbon Footprint Considerations

The travel industry is notably one of the largest contributors to global greenhouse gas emissions. According to a report by the International Air Transport Association (IATA), air travel accounted for about 2-3% of global CO2 emissions in 2019. With the rise of AI, companies are now better positioned to optimize operations, thus potentially reducing their carbon outputs. For instance, AI can enhance fuel efficiency through route optimization, significantly decreasing operational emissions. This kind of proactive approach to reducing carbon footprints is vital in combating climate change.

The Role of AI in Promoting Eco-Friendly Accommodations

Personalized Recommendations

AI enhances the traveler’s journey by providing personalized accommodation recommendations that align with eco-friendly ideals. By analyzing user preferences, AI can suggest hotels that prioritize sustainability, whether through energy-efficient design, local sourcing of food, or community engagement. Services like Booking.com utilize AI algorithms to filter results to show properties with environmentally friendly practices. These developments highlight how technology can directly influence sustainable choices.
